Find the surface area of a cube with sides 8 cm.

The surface area of a cube can be calculated by using the formula shown below:


SA=6a^2

Where "a" is the length of any edge of the cube.

In this case, you know that:


a=8\operatorname{cm}

Then, you can substitute this value into the formula:


SA=(6)(8\operatorname{cm})^2

Finally, evaluating, you get the following result:


\begin{gathered} SA=(6)(64\operatorname{cm}^2) \\ SA=384\operatorname{cm}^2 \end{gathered}

Therefore, the answer is:


SA=384\operatorname{cm}^2
